I am finishing up on my Afrika Korps sdkfz 250 and want to put the name IGEL or Adler on the half-track, but trying to get better information on them is hard.

I know there were three half-tracks. One named Greif (Rommel's half-track) and two others IGEL and ADLER. There is very little information on the last two.

Several items of information can be found. For sure there are many photos of Rommel riding on GREIF. But who did the other two belong to?

One person had a good theory where GREIF is the command track and the other two belong to either the Luftwaffe Liaison or commander the other belonging to the artillery liaison or commander. All being in the command group. But I have never seen a photo that even shows two of them in the same photo.

I thought I had read somewhere Where IGEL and ADler belonged to the commanders of the 15th and 21st Panzer Divisions. Of course I can't remember what book I may have read it in.
